Abstract

The invention discloses a safety protection device for an injection needle, and belongs to the technical field of medical instruments. One end of a sheath of the device is opened, a pair of clamping hooks is arranged on the rear end wall or the wall bottom of the sheath, a pair of buckled buckles is oppositely arranged on a needle base and the sheath, and an elastic positioning device with the limiting function is arranged at the connection position of the needle base and the sheath. The elastic positioning device is arranged and can assist a medical worker in clamping in the operation process, safety is ensured further, and when the medical worker handles abandoned syringe needles on a large scale, the operation efficiency is improved; a protection wall is arranged outside the buckles, the buckles can move in place conveniently due to the protection wall serving as a limiter when the syringe needles are abandoned, the buckles can be protected and prevented from loosening due to external force, barb-shaped protrusions can firmly compress and limit needle tubings in the safe sheath, and the limiting similarly has the further safety function.

Background technology
Data according to the relevent statistics, China is injection, transfusion, the most general country of blood sampling.Hospital and each medical institutions have a large amount of used entry needles to go out of use every year.Utilize for fear of environmental pollution and refuse secondary, need to used entry needle be recycled by professional institution.In order to prevent that in removal process unexpected injury or superinfection are to related personnel, hygiene department needs a kind of needle protecting arrangement simple in structure, safe and reliable badly.At present, people advise using a kind of syringe that uses rear syringe needle can retract in medicinal liquid cavity, but this type of syringe construction complexity, and cost is higher, is difficult to large scale application.
Patent 201310213076.8 discloses a kind of safety protective cover; this protective sleeve is used for receiving syringe needle; opening protective sleeve by Connection Block and side forms; side is opened protective sleeve and is connected by hinged mode with Connection Block; in Connection Block and containing cavity, set up upright inverse tying plate, between the sidewall that Connection Block and needle tubing containing cavity are relative and Connection Block, be provided with snap device.This safety protective cover has played certain safeguard protection effect; its shortcoming is, hinged mode is not easy location, and medical worker is in the time carrying out trocar operation; usually produce secondary operation because location is inaccurate; and easily prick the hand, built on the sand, syringe needle is easily from the sidepiece slippage of inverse tying plate for the structure of inverse tying plate fixed needle; the draw-in groove of this patent is arranged on Connection Block; grab is arranged on side and opens on the inwall of protective sleeve, and such structure arranges easy slippage, built on the sand.
Patent 201110270127.1 discloses a kind of needle guard mechanisms and safety needle assembly; structure is very complicated; be not easy preparation; between its sheath and Connection Block, be also in the mode with hinged; the location of carrying out syringe needle in two holding sections is set to be fixed; this structure, in the time that operator operate, is also not easy location, causes the low problem of operating efficiency.
